We will have 3 elections in 2010. The school Election is May 4. August 3 is the Primary Election to nominate candidates for state Govenor, as well as state and federal Senators and Representatives. The General Election will be November 2, 2010.
If you have not registered to vote, you can obtain a mail-in voter registration form by clicking on the following link: http://www.michigan.gov/documents/MIVoterRegistration_97046_7.pdf
The law now states in order to receive a ballot, you must show picture proof of identification. This can be a Michigan Drivers License, a Michigan Personal Identification Card or a United States Passport.
Check your voters’ ID card or the Precinct Map as to where you vote. You can go online to check whether you are registered and the location where you vote. www.michigan.gov/vote
